{"product_id":"historic-winter-storms-of-new-jersey-disaster","title":"Historic Winter Storms of New Jersey","description":"\u003cp\u003eCrippling winter storms are locked in the memories of millions of New Jerseyans.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eOn December 26, 1947, an unpredicted storm buried Newark in twenty-six inches of snow. A record-setting nor’easter on January 22, 2016, unleashed sixty-mile-per-hour wind gusts, six-foot drifts and snowfall depths of thirty inches in Bernards Township and Long Valley. But no storm was more infamous than the so-called Great White Hurricane. Coming when the science of meteorology was in its infancy, the blizzard of 1888 left tens of millions at the mercy of a vicious three-day nightmare with tragic loss of life and property that no one saw coming.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eAuthor Don Colgan tells the stories of winter’s fury and of those who lived through the most extraordinary winter storms in New Jersey history.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"The Cranford Bookstore","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":47569858363549,"sku":"9781467170000","price":24.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0690\/9218\/0125\/files\/9781467170000.jpg?v=1768430635","url":"https:\/\/thecranfordbookstore.com\/products\/historic-winter-storms-of-new-jersey-disaster","provider":"The Cranford Bookstore","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
